Bruno Rocca’s Barbaresco Rabajà is a single‑cru Nebbiolo from the historic Rabajà vineyard—part of the Rocca family estate since 1958—renowned for white and gray marl soils and concentrated, ageworthy wines. It typically shows roses and red cherry layered with tobacco, spice and stony mineral notes, framed by ripe yet gripping tannins from measured oak aging; a robust, terroir‑driven Barbaresco that rewards cellaring.
